i was actually thinking about Yokohama Advan Neova AD07. but what is turning me off is the 180 tread-wear. i'm a very aggressive driver and that won't cut it for me. man! deciding tires is really hard. i want a good tire that is very sticky and can actually grip. after 10k on my stock tires, they can't hold for nothing. i was going for the S03's but some people say its not worth it.
